Homogenizers are used to break down sample, including food products, cosmetics, soil, plant matter, tissues, and more, before those samples are analyzed. The goal of homogenization is to produce a sample with the analytes of interest dispersed uniformly throughout. There are handheld and bench-mounted configurations available, along with a variety of probes to match various sample types.
